Mexican eatery offers delicious menu, drinks in festive atmosphere
ORLANDO, Fla. - CuisineWire -- Get ready, fans of tacos, burritos and margaritas. The fiesta has arrived in downtown Orlando!
F&D Cantina has opened its second location in Thornton Park. The highly anticipated restaurant, located at 617 E. Central Blvd., is the sister to F&D Cantina in Lake Mary, which attracts droves of loyal fans with its festive atmosphere, excellent service and top-notch Mexican-inspired fare.
"We've built quite a reputation up at the Lake Mary location," said Charly Robinson, owner and founder of the F&D family of restaurants. "Thornton Park is an exciting area. There's a lot of growth, and there are a lot of people we think are looking for a spot like this. We thought it was a perfect fit."
F&D Cantina Thornton Park will deliver the same fun feel as the original, with striking art and décor to set the mood, as well as a showpiece bar to serve up the eatery's signature margaritas.

But the real draw will be the full menu of Mexican-inspired favorites. F&D Cantina serves up incredible dips, including queso and guacamole, delicious street tacos, and takes on Mexican favorites like chile rellenos and enchiladas. The menu also includes a variety of vegetarian and vegan options, including Beyond plant-based meats.
The location will also offer several specials, including $5 House Margarita Mondays and Taco Tuesdays. F&D Cantina was named Best Mexican Restaurant by the Orlando Sentinel in 2020.
F&D Cantina is part of the F&D family of restaurants, which includes F&D Kitchen and Bar in Lake Mary and the F&D Woodfired Italian Kitchen brand, which includes locations in the Hourglass District, Longwood and Winter Park.
